
An eviction drive targeting approximately 6,200 bighas of encroached Compensatory Afforestation land has commenced in Assam's Sonitpur district, within the Burhachapori Wildlife Sanctuary. The operation, led by the district administration and forest department, aims to clear land occupied by around 710 households for dwellings and agriculture. Despite prior notices, most occupants did not vacate, prompting the current large-scale clearing effort involving significant personnel and machinery.
